Essential Responsibilities/Tasks:

  • Professionally represent the Paul Davis principles of honesty and integrity
  • Perform any and all directives from Mitigation Manager
  • Respond to emergency losses
  • Perform Emergency Water Extraction and Drying Services (including water extraction, demolition, moisture testing, developing drying plans, and providing project documentation)
  • Assist in Emergency Fire/Smoke Services (to include demolition, cleaning, deodorization, inventorying, pack outs, board-ups, and securing the structure)
  • Assist in Mold Remediation (including demolition and cleaning)
  • Assist in preparation and completion of Carpet/Upholstery Cleaning
  • Participate and fulfill on-call rotation as needed, typically one weekend per month and one weeknight per week (responding to after hour emergencies)
  • Perform basic vehicle, equipment, and building maintenance
  • Able to safely climb a ladder
  • Able to lift at least 75 pounds
  • Able to work in confined spaces
  • Able to work around a variety of chemicals without any adverse reaction or sensitivity
  • Communicate as the primary point of contact with customer
  • Complete work authorizations
  • Complete compliance tasks and update job files daily
  • Manage a crew
